Oura has implemented major modifications to the algorithm that determines the Readiness Score of the Oura Ring, aimed at providing women monitoring their menstrual cycles with a more precise and helpful metric. This update is part of an announcement that the company will collaborate with Scripps Research Digital Trials Center to enhance our understanding of physiological changes during pregnancy.
The algorithm alteration will adjust the Readiness Score, which is derived from sleep patterns, body temperature, heart rate, heart rate variability (HRV), and other sensor data, to reflect the user’s cycle, thereby offering a more accurate assessment that facilitates daily condition tracking. Oura indicates that approximately 65% of users may experience changes in their scores due to the natural variations in key data points during the luteal phase of their cycle; however, the Readiness Score is expected to be lower on only about three percent of monitored days.
“The menstrual cycle significantly influences women’s health and overall well-being, which is why we are committed to ensuring our app features accurately incorporate the latest scientific insights into the physiological shifts women undergo. By basing our product on thorough research, we're enabling women to confidently manage their unique cycles with the most precise and tailored data available,” stated Holly Shelton, Oura’s chief product officer.
The new study forms part of this dedication. It will gather data from 10,000 women who have used the Oura Ring during pregnancy and will examine how physiological changes can influence pregnancy and related complications. The study aims to enhance understanding of issues such as preterm labor, the risk of miscarriage, and postpartum depression. Interested participants can apply to join the study via the Oura app.
